"This year we decided to shift to three Night with Cougar Athletics events for both recruiting and financial reasons. Moving from two separate weeks of events to one allows our coaches to get back on the road earlier and continue recruiting the next generation of Cougs. After consideration, we decided that the markets of Spokane, Tri-Cities, and Seattle made more sense for us financially in terms of total dollars fundraised. At this time, we are not sure if this will be a permanent or temporary change."
